Output 2c21d720247c6f7f70a76325e45105789df614081c123203bdac87b762a1ee80:0

value
3152253
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d004755463b81d3ed0f1345dc4a92c9f42659f2b OP_EQUALVERIFY OP_CHECKSIG
address
1KxttfsQjSWHqPW9v64ReFRRdFcEFy75uR
transaction
2c21d720247c6f7f70a76325e45105789df614081c123203bdac87b762a1ee80
spent
true